  • Statistics for West Palm Beach, Florida
  • The population of West Palm Beach is 322,940. Of that number, 157,166 are Males and 165,774 are Females.

    West Palm Beach, Florida population breakdown by age is as follows:

    6.33 % are Under Age 5
    7.02 % are 5 to 9 Years Old
    7.35 % are 10 to 14 Years Old
    6.54 % are 15 to 19 Years Old
    5.65 % are 20 to 24 Years Old
    13.74 % are 25 to 34 Years Old
    16.49 % are 35 to 44 Years Old
    12.73 % are 45 to 54 Years Old
    4.50 % are 55 to 59 Years Old
    3.83 % are 60 to 64 Years Old
    7.46 % are 65 to 74 Years Old
    5.89 % are 75 to 84 Years Old
    2.46 % are over 85 Years Old

    West Palm Beach Stats
    The Total Area covered by West Palm Beach, Florida is 184.27 Sq. Miles.
    The population density in West Palm Beach, FL. is 1,767.78 persons/sq. mile.
    The West Palm Beach elevation is 21 Ft.

    Enrollment and Education for West Palm Beach:
    83,411 students are enrolled in school in West Palm Beach, Florida (over 3 years of age).
    Of those who are enrolled in West Palm Beach:
    6,116 students are attending Nursery School in West Palm Beach.
    4,528 students are enrolled in Kindergarten.
    38,878 students in West Palm Beach are enrolled in Primary School
    18,846 students attend High School in West Palm Beach.
    15,043 students attend College in West Palm Beach.
    West Palm Beach Employment Info:
    145,768 people are employed in West Palm Beach.
    8,089 people are unemployed in West Palm Beach, Florida.
    Data on Household Economics in West Palm Beach:
    Household earnings breakdown:
    Under $10,000 yearly: 12,609
    $10,000.00 to $14,999 yearly: 8,720
    $15,000 to $24,999 yearly: 18,371
    $25,000 to $34,999 yearly: 17,504
    $35,000 to $49,999 yearly: 21,389
    $50,000 to $74,999 yearly: 24,030
    $75,000 to $99,999 yearly: 10,935
    $100,000 to $149,999 yearly: 8,801
    $150,000 to $199,999 yearly: 2,202
    $200,000 or more yearly: 3,275

Once someone makes it to drug and alcohol rehab in West Palm Beach, FL., drug and alcohol detox is the course of action that is always the first important step of an extremely complete and extensive treatment plan. During an alcohol or drug detoxification, individuals who are just beginning to abstain from drugs will begin experiencing intense withdrawal symptoms as the drugs are leaving their bodies. Treatment clients must readjust both physically and psychologically to these changes and often takes a substantial volume of will power to avoid relapse during this time, which would ease these extreme and sometimes painful and punishing set of symptoms. Detox specialists at a drug rehab program in West Palm Beach, FL. understand what set of symptoms every drug and/or alcohol will bring during withdrawal, and know how to tackle them so that detoxification goes smoothly and is a safe course of action. This will ensure that there is nothing which will cause relapse and that the person gets through detoxification so they can move onto the more crucial elements of rehab.

After detoxification, it is crucial that the individual in treatment at a drug and alcohol rehab facility in West Palm Beach, FL. and their friends and family members understand that this is not by any means the end of the rehab process. Just quitting drugs and detoxing alone isn't considered treatment in itself, it is simply the beginning of a much more in-depth process which entails many weeks of counseling and therapy to truly address drug or alcohol addiction and fully resolve it. Rehab experts will work with the treatment client to uncover and address what induced their alcohol and drug abuse and how to prevent this from taking place in the future. One-on-one and peer group counseling is frequently used in addition to training and behavioral treatment to help foster more helpful coping methods that will give clients a much better chance at not only staying off drugs but living a complete and joyful existence.
